Affinity Photo 2 for iPad

Like Photoshop, Affinity Photo 2 has an iPad edition. In fact, Affinity was the first to produce an iPad version, long before Adobe, and it’s a remarkably fully featured app that has most of the tools of the full desktop version and is extremely well adapted for a touch interface.

This article is a basic tutorial on how it works and what you can do with it. Affinity does not have an equivalent to Adobe’s Creative Cloud online ecosystem, so the iPad version shares files with the Affinity Photo 2 desktop application via Apple’s iCloud setup. It’s pretty basic by comparison but works perfectly well and for many users it’s going to be perfectly adequate.
